Kraiburg TPE has introduced a thermoplastic elastomer (TPE) material designed for wireless earbuds and other consumer electronics requiring integrated LED lighting.
According to the company, its Light Effect TPE combines "high light transmission" with a soft-touch surface, while offering adhesion to polypropylene (PP) for overmoulded components.
The material is intended for applications including LED status indicators, touch-control areas and illuminated branding elements, enabling LEDs to remain concealed when switched off while providing uniform light transmission during operation.
The German compounder said the material also features low odour and low volatile organic compound (VOC) emissions, making it suitable for products that come into direct contact with the skin.
The TPE is designed to provide durability under repeated use and offers UV and weather resistance for long-term performance, the company added.
For manufacturers, the material provides "excellent adhesion" to PP, supporting overmoulding of soft and rigid components. It also offers flow properties suited to complex part geometries and lightweight product designs.
According to the company, the series complies with the IEC 61249-2-21 halogen-free standard.
In addition to wireless earbuds, the material is intended for smartwatches, wearable devices, smart home products, gaming controllers, household appliances, displays and LED indicator components.
